Listings | Midwest | Clinical Nurse Consultant

Location: Chicago, IL
Territory Covered: Upper half of Illinois and Indiana
Specialty: Oncology
Description:

The Clinical Nurse Consultant will promote the companies products in the oncology nursing segment, and maximize sales and earnings for an assigned geographical area

Responsibilities will include, but are not limited to, the following:
•Identifies and accesses key customers and promotes The company’s products to meet and/or exceed sales and profit objectives
•Develops and implements business plan to drive sales and meet customer needs
•Deliver presentations to nursing groups, societies and other pertinent venues.
•Partner with influential nursing organizations, targeted accounts, and national, state and local societies to drive disease state related educational initiatives in a promotional context within product labeling.
•Work closely with marketing to identify nursing specific tools to leverage with customers •Maintains open dialogue with key opinion leaders in nursing arena and develops product champions
•Manages resources effectively while maintaining accurate records of company related expenditures
•Communicate and coordinate sales efforts with sales representatives, sales management and other corporate support as part of a concerted sales effort
•Identify and communicate field issues, opportunities, and competitive activities through appropriate organizational venues
•Attends and participates in sales meetings, training classes, conventions, and other business activities Skills/Knowledge Required:
•Minimum of Bachelors Degree in Nursing or related sciences
•Additional relevant sales and marketing experience •Minimum five years of oncology experience, either clinically or industry
•Demonstrates an in-depth knowledge of the oncology market, preferably focused on the pharmaceutical industry.
•Demonstrates excellent written and oral communication skills •Ability to utilize customer relationships and develop traditional and non-traditional customer relationships to further business opportunities
•Demonstrates expert knowledge in related disease states and the ability to serve as a technical and clinical resource to the medical community
•Ability to target, develop and maintain a customer base
•Ability to utilize account knowledge to resolve issues common to various customer segments •Demonstrate effective influence skills with customer teams to maximize promotional/other programs •Demonstrate customer literacy and ability to interpret clinical and market data

Job Requirements: PREREQUISITES Minimum BS degree in Nursing/related area, 5 years Oncology clinical/industry experience
Compensation: Compensation package includes competitive salary commensurate with experience and UNCAPPED BONUS potential
Benefits: Outstanding benefits including company car, 401K, stock options, medical and dental benefits.
Travel Requirements: 30%
